Two European heavyweights are set to collide in a massive pre-tournament structural test. On Tuesday, June 2, Croatia will play host to Belgium at the Stadion HNK Rijeka for a high-profile international friendly. With the 2026 World Cup rapidly approaching, both veteran-led sides are using this marquee fixture as a critical tactical tune-up to finalize their conditioning and roster chemistry.

Managed by Zlatko Dalić, the Croatian squad enters this fixture looking to establish consistent physical output following a mixed March international window.
Recent Form: Croatia secured a hard-fought 2-1 victory over Colombia in March but subsequently suffered a 3-1 deficit against Brazil in Orlando.
The World Cup Path: The Vatreni qualified for the big stage on the back of an impressive, unbeaten Group L campaign.
The Countdown: This friendly serves as crucial preparation for their highly anticipated World Cup opener against England in Dallas on June 17.
Belgium’s Engine: High-Output Momentum
The Red Devils arrive in Rijeka operating at a very high athletic baseline, carrying immense momentum into the summer.
The Streak: Belgium is currently riding a stellar 11-match unbeaten streak across all competitions.
March Momentum: Their spring window featured a dominant 5-2 blowout against the United States in Atlanta, followed by a gritty 1-1 draw with Mexico in Chicago.
The World Cup Path: Belgium has been drawn into World Cup Group G, where they will face Egypt, Iran, and New Zealand.
Historical Context
Tuesday’s clash serves as a highly anticipated rematch of their 2022 World Cup group stage encounter, which ended in a physically exhausting 0-0 deadlock. With both squads possessing massive amounts of big-game tournament experience, this fixture will test each team’s tactical stamina and defensive organization.
